MERITUS Talent are working with a leading defence and national security contractor who are well embedded into the UK defence industry, for the recruitment of a Business Development & Capture Manager to join their Cheltenham office on a permanent, hybrid basis.
Overview
A leading defence technology business is hiring a Business Development & Capture Manager to support a growing pipeline of opportunities within its UK Cyber & Intelligence division. This role sits within the wider Business Development & Capture team and reports to the Head of BD for Cyber & Intelligence. The division is focused on delivering secure, scalable technology solutions to defence and national security customers undergoing complex digital transformation.
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the identification, qualification, and pursuit of new business opportunities within the Cyber & Intelligence domain.
  • Develop and execute capture strategies and business cases to maximise win probability (Pwin).
  • Drive capture activity through internal reviews and decision gates.
  • Collaborate with delivery and operations teams to align capture plans with resourcing and commercial considerations.
  • Build strong relationships with industrial partners and customers.
  • Provide regular input to pipeline and growth reviews.
  • Act as Capture Manager for high-value and strategic bids.
  • Support broader BD activity across the business, including strategy development and market analysis.

About You

  • At least 5 years\’ experience in business development, sales or capture roles within the defence, government or national security sectors.
  • Strong track record of securing new business and leading successful capture efforts.
  • Experience engaging directly with customers across the bid lifecycle.
  • Familiarity with structured capture methodologies such as Shipley (preferred).
  • Comfortable navigating matrix organisations and working across functional teams.
  • Eligible for UK Government Security Clearance (SC).
